Day 3: The Refining Process of Letting Go

God’s path to victory often involves a process of refinement, where He pares down our resources and even our relationships. He removes what we perceive as necessary to show us that He alone is our essential need. This process can feel like loss, but it is actually a gracious act to protect us from self-reliance and pride. It is a weeding out of anything that might cause us to take credit for what only God can do. The goal is to bring us to a place of total dependence, where our trust is in His provision alone.

So he brought the people down to the water. And the Lord said to Gideon, “Every one who laps the water with his tongue, as a dog laps, you shall set by himself. Likewise, every one who kneels down to drink.” (Judges 7:5 ESV)

Reflection: Is there a person, a possession, or a personal ability you have been leaning on for security that God might be asking you to release? How can you actively choose to depend on Him more fully in that area this week?
